The SIG SAUER 7.62X51MM NATO SEMI AUTOMATIC 20 ROUNDS 13 BARREL is a high-performance, large-format pistol built on the proven MCX platform. It delivers rifle-caliber power in a compact, semi-automatic package designed for precision and control. This model bridges the gap between a heavy-hitting carbine and a maneuverable sidearm, offering the ballistic authority of 7.62x51mm NATO (.308 Winchester) from a 13-inch barrel. Specifications & Details

Specification Detail
Caliber 7.62x51mm NATO / .308 Winchester
Action Semi-Automatic, Short-Stroke Piston
Barrel Length 13 inches
Capacity 20 Rounds (Magazine Included)
Weight 7.6 lbs (unloaded)
Platform SIG MCX

Weighing in at 7.6 pounds, this isn’t a light firearm, but that mass helps manage the substantial recoil of the .308 cartridge. The 13-inch barrel provides a significant ballistic advantage over shorter pistol-caliber platforms while remaining legally distinct from a Short-Barreled Rifle (SBR) when configured with an arm brace.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Is this considered a rifle or a pistol?

A: As configured from the factory with a pistol brace (if included) and a 13″ barrel, it is legally classified as a pistol. An FFL transfer is required for purchase. Always confirm current federal and state regulations, especially regarding stabilizing braces.

Q: What kind of effective range can I expect?

A: With the 7.62x51mm cartridge from a 13-inch barrel, effective range on man-sized targets can extend to 500+ yards with proper ammunition and shooter skill. That said, expect some velocity loss compared to a 16-inch or longer rifle barrel.

Q: Are magazines and parts easy to find?

A: Yes. It uses SIG SR-25/AR-10 pattern magazines, which are widely available from SIG and other manufacturers like Magpul (PMAG .308). Many controls and accessories are compatible with the standard MCX ecosystem.
